Yo Sunshine, no fool should ever judge a guy in shorts and no pads. No QB should be judged that cannot get hit. Preseason game planning is at a minimum. Rotation is heavy. Plays calls are vanilla. Preseason does not mean shit. But if you cannot block in preseason and get protections right your probably will be benched by week 2. Both lines need work and this is not set.
1990 Atalanta Falcons under first year coach Jerry Glanville destroyed every team in the preseason and went 4-0. First game of the season they hung 47 on the Oilers. Everyone in Atalanta was thinking Super Bowl. The media went nuts for them. They were dirty, playing with attitude and they only won 5 games the whole year.
Truth is after 3 weeks of tape every defense coordinator knows what you want to do and how you do it. They start taking things away. No team is giving week one opponents good tape from preseason. Week 4 the real teams are separated from the posers. I will not judge Hue till after that. He has done nothing so far that I have not seen before in Cleveland.
